    We apologize for the inconvenience you’re experiencing with connecting Google services in the wizard set-up. To resolve this issue, please follow these steps:

    1. Navigate to your Google Account and remove the Rank Math app from the list of third-party apps with account access. You can find Rank Math under “Third-party apps with Account access” and click the “Remove Access” button.

    2. After removing the app, reconnect Rank Math with your Google account by heading over to Rank Math SEO → General Settings → Analytics, and clicking on the “Reconnect” button at the top.

    3. Allow all permissions when prompted.

    4. In the Analytics settings of Rank Math, select all the values in the drop-down list to configure Analytics properties and then click on “Save Changes.”

    You should receive a notice similar to the one shown below after 30 seconds of clicking the “Save Changes” button (page reload required).

    The issue is caused by the lack of permission. Please follow the steps below to fix it.

    1. Make sure that you have verified Google Search Console, if not, follow this guide: https://rankmath.com/kb/google-site-verification/

    2. Please make sure that you are not connecting to Google Search Console via a domain property but rather a URL prefix and that you have verified the correct version of your website on the Google Search Console (HTTP or HTTPS, www or non-www).

    3. Then remove Rank Math’s access from Google Please remove RankMath’s app from your Google apps permissions: https://myaccount.google.com/permissions

    4. Reconnect the Google account again to regenerate the auth token from Google, by going to WordPress Dashboard > Rank Math > General Settings > Analytics and configure the Search Console and Analytics settings again.

    Kindly check all necessary checkboxes to allow Rank Math to access some of the Google Services.
